3.0 out of 5 stars
Dead or Alive? You'll figure it out,
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
This review is from: Dead or Alive (Paperback)
Meg O'Hara's husband was reported dead, but it appears that he is leaving clues to let her know he is really alive. Bill Coverdale, "her old friend," is helping her get to the bottom of the case. It turns out Robin O'Hara was a spy before he disappeared, and was onto something big. Since his death is in question, she cannot collect on her meager inheritance, so she should fall back to her rich, reclusive uncle for money; she cannot take any from Coverdale. This is the first Patricia Wentworth book where I figured out the solution by about page 50. If they had called in Miss Silver, she would have solved the case in her sitting room. I think she would have coughed discretely and slapped Meg. "Perhaps you should wake up and smell the coffee!" The only surprise was a character from another of her stories. There is good action, and a lot of twists to the plot. So some people will probably love it.
I am a big fan, having read quite a few Wentworth books, both with Miss Silver and without, but this one disappointed me. |
